What does a localization project manager do?

A localization project manager oversees the process of adapting products, content, or software for different languages and cultures. They coordinate teams, set timelines, manage budgets, and ensure quality standards are met using tools like translation management systems. Their role ensures that localized materials are accurate, culturally appropriate, and delivered on schedule.

How much do localization project managers make in the US?

Localization project managers in the US typically earn between $70,000 and $120,000 annually, depending on experience, location, and company size. Salaries can vary based on skills such as translation management tools and familiarity with industry standards.

Can an intern be a project manager?

An intern can take on project management tasks or assist with project coordination, but they typically do not hold the full responsibilities of a project manager role. Internships often focus on learning and supporting existing projects under supervision, and formal project management requires experience, certifications, and authority that interns usually do not have. However, some internship programs may include leadership opportunities or project management training for high-performing interns.
